After working with the support of Blackberry, they have achknowledged behavior is constant in the devices and the problem of development has intensified. They say a future update will solve the problem and allow the Hub to open xlsm files. In the meantime, the best solution I found is to save all the xlsm files in your download folder and then open them using ES Explorer Google game store. He is smart enough to open them with leaves.
